Problem
Conventional robot cleaners face inefficiencies in cleaning large spaces, requiring position recognition marks or laser points for region setting, which can be cumbersome and prone to malfunctions, and struggle with precise positioning and repeated cleaning of specific regions.
Innovation Solution
A robot cleaner system that allows for manual setting of desired cleaning regions without conventional position recognition marks or laser points, using a terminal device to transmit remote control signals for designated region setting and cleaning commands, enabling precise and concentrated cleaning operations.

Disclosed are a robot cleaner, a controlling method of the same, and a robot cleaning system. The robot cleaner can perform a cleaning operation with respect to only a user's desired region, in a repeated and concentrated manner. Further, as the robot cleaner runs on a user's desired region in a manual manner, a designated region can be precisely set. Further, as the robot cleaner performs a cleaning operation by setting a user's desired region, only a simple configuration is added to a terminal device such as a remote control unit. Accordingly, additional costs can be reduced, and a malfunction can be prevented.
